代码签名证书的作用:操作系统为什么需要代码签名

时间:2025-12-06 分类:操作系统

代码签名证书在现代操作系统中扮演着至关重要的角色,尤其是在保障软件安全性和用户信任方面。随着网络环境日益复杂和不安全,代码签名成为了一种有效的安全防护手段。通过数字签名,软件开发者能够证明其应用程序的来源和完整性,从而保护终端用户免受恶意软件和病毒的攻击。代码签名还帮助操作系统维护自身生态的健康,确保只有经过审核和验证的应用程序能够在系统中运行。这不仅提升了用户体验,还增强了用户申请安装软件时的信心。

代码签名证书的作用:操作系统为什么需要代码签名

代码签名技术通过对软件进行加密,可以确保软件在传输过程中未被篡改。每当用户下载一个应用程序时,操作系统会检查其数字签名,验证其与发布者的身份是否相匹配。这一过程有效防止了恶意软件假借合法软件的名义进行传播。通过这种方式,用户能够更放心地使用新应用,避免了因下载虚假程序而导致的损失。

代码签名证书还在应用程序的安装过程中起到验证作用。当用户尝试安装某个应用时,操作系统会根据签名信息判断是否允许该程序执行。如果软件缺乏有效的代码签名,系统通常会发出警告甚至阻止安装。这样一来,用户在安装软件时能够获得更高的安全保障,大大降低了操作系统受到攻击的风险。

企业和开发者的信誉也与代码签名密切相关。有了数字签名,用户能够清楚地识别出软件的来源。这为开发者与用户之间建立信任提供了保障,进而促进了软件的推广与使用。用户在选择下载软件时,更倾向于选用那些具备可靠签名的应用,这不仅能保护他们的设备,还能为开发者塑造良好的产品形象。

代码签名证书在操作系统中不仅是安全保障的工具,更是技术与用户之间的桥梁。随着网络攻防形势的变化,代码签名的必要性愈发凸显。未来,随着技术的不断进步和安全需求的提高,代码签名将会更加普及,成为软件开发与使用中不可或缺的一部分。通过加强代码签名措施,操作系统能够为用户提供更加安全、可靠的计算环境。